Besides the usual mailing list communication, real-time communication takes place on Internet Relay Chat (IRC). An IRC Quick Start guide is available here.
[edit] irc.freenode.net
[edit] #gslug
- This channel on Freenode is gaining quite a bit of popularity now, and people are back to being active in it. Join us here!
[edit] #ubuntu-pnw
- This is the channel for the Ubuntu Pacific Northwest team, several GSLUG'ers hang out in here.
[edit] EFNet
[edit] #neg9
- Neg9 is not directly related to GSLUG, however many people who attend GSLUG meetings are in this channel. Neg9 is a social group of people interested in security, and provides hosting for the GSLUG website/wiki.
[edit] IRC Clients
Popular IRC clients include...
- XChat
- Pidgin (formerly called Gaim)
- irssi
- ircII
- BitchX
- ii
- Kopete - for KDE
- Chatzilla (part of SeaMonkey Internet application Suite)
